What Affects Residential & Commercial Roofing Costs in Ellabell?
Understanding pricing factors helps you budget accurately and avoid surprises
labor costs
Labor rates in Bryan County are typically moderate, lower than nearby Savannah but competitive for skilled roofers. Experience levels and crew size impact the total—rush jobs after storms cost more. Local pros often bundle labor with materials for better value.
market dynamics
High demand during hurricane season strains supply, pushing prices up. Fewer contractors in rural Ellabell means busier schedules, but steady work keeps rates stable otherwise. Material shortages from national supply chains can add variability.
seasonal trends
Peak pricing hits June-November with hurricane risks; off-season winter may offer deals. Spring repairs are common and balanced; avoid summer heat delays that extend timelines.
🧱 Key Pricing Components
- ✓ Roof size and pitch: Larger or steeper roofs require more time and safety gear.
- ✓ Materials chosen: Asphalt shingles are basic; metal, tile, or premium options add cost.
- ✓ Labor and demo: Crew wages, old roof removal, and disposal fees.
- ✓ Extras: Vents, chimneys, gutters, or underlayment upgrades.
- ✓ Permits and inspections: Required in Bryan County for most jobs.

How to Save Money on Residential & Commercial Roofing
Smart strategies to get quality service without overpaying
Tip
- Request at least 3 quotes from licensed, insured Bryan County roofers.
Tip
- Share roof measurements, photos, and material preferences for accurate bids.
Tip
- Insist on a detailed breakdown: labor, materials, removal, and any add-ons.
Tip
- Compare similar scopes—watch for differences in warranties or cleanup.
Tip
- Ask about payment terms; avoid big upfront payments.
Pricing Red Flags
Warning Sign
Unusually low quotes: May signal subpar materials, unlicensed work, or no warranty.
Warning Sign
Hidden fees: Vague bids without listing permits, disposal, or travel charges.
Warning Sign
Pressure tactics: 'Sign now before price hike' or door-to-door storm chasers.
Warning Sign
No contract details: Missing insurance proof, timelines, or change order policies.
Pricing Questions
Common questions about residential & commercial roofing costs in Ellabell
💬 What most affects roofing costs in Ellabell?
Key drivers are roof size, pitch, material type, and current weather events.
Residential jobs scale with square footage; commercial adds complexity like flat roofs or height.
Get site-specific quotes for precision.
💬 Are asphalt shingles cheaper than metal roofing?
Yes, asphalt is typically the most affordable option for both residential and commercial.
Metal lasts longer in Georgia's humid climate but costs more upfront.
Weigh longevity vs. budget with local pros.
💬 Do commercial roofs cost more than residential?
Usually yes, due to larger areas, specialized materials, and stricter safety codes.
Flat commercial roofs often need different techniques than sloped residential ones.
Quotes reflect the added scope and liability.
💬 When do prices spike in Bryan County?
After storms or during hurricane season—demand surges, crews book up fast.
Materials may shortage too.
Plan ahead or negotiate off-peak for savings.
💬 Should I get multiple quotes?
Absolutely—compare 3+ from vetted locals to spot fair market value.
Ensure bids match your specs.
Check reviews and licenses via Bryan County resources.
💬 What about permits and fees?
Bryan County requires permits for most roof work—factor in $100s typically.
Reputable pros handle this transparently.
